DIC Corp (OTC: DICCF) is a Japan-based multinational company primarily engaged in the production and sale of printing inks, coatings, and various chemical products. Established in 1907, DIC has evolved into a significant player in the global market, known for its innovative solutions and comprehensive product lineup that includes packaging materials, adhesives, and specialty chemicals.
The company operates through several business segments, which include the Printing & Packaging segment, Chemical Products segment, and Others, encompassing products like fine chemicals and functional materials. DIC Corp manufactures and sells a variety of chemicals and chemical-based products. The company organizes itself into four segments based on product type. The printing inks segment, which generates the most revenue of any segment, sells inks used for publishing as well as inks and adhesives used for packaging. The polymers segment sells synthetic resins used in electronics and automobiles. The fine chemicals segment sells liquid crystals used for televisions and monitors as well as pigments for color filters. The application materials segment sells industrial adhesive tape as well as materials used for coating, printing, and molding.
